Transaction 75737ddb9065c1bb2cfd199adf29f2abd1e1989317afa07fc3c4272fa9c4e651

1 Input
2 Outputs
  • 75737ddb9065c1bb2cfd199adf29f2abd1e1989317afa07fc3c4272fa9c4e651:0
  • value  79554685
    address  12gmSFyJmCuJeqm8W6Q4vTeeaPZn5kAb7v
  • 75737ddb9065c1bb2cfd199adf29f2abd1e1989317afa07fc3c4272fa9c4e651:1
  • value  2040402017
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F